Listing material

Listed by Peninsula Sotheby's International Realty Sorrento

Sorrento Beach House Meets Après Ski

Recently completed by the acclaimed RACM Constructions and designed by RR-id, this architectural tour de force seamlessly harmonises with its Sorrento surroundings while boldly reimagining modern coastal design. Defined by its dual-pod layout and remarkable proportions, this home is purposefully crafted to foster connection. From its seamless indoor-outdoor flow and bespoke poolside retreat to the thoughtful separation of its two wings, every element has been carefully designed for low-maintenance, high-impact living just 300m (approx) from Sorrento Village.

Lush, verdant landscaping by RRL Landscapes frames the timber facade, while an established date palm with a striking circular stone border creates a dramatic yet inviting entrance. A dual-sided Obilca wood-burning fireplace connects the outdoor living room to the breathtaking interiors, where spectacular five-meter-high raked ceilings and exquisite glacial American oak portal beams soar above the expansive living and dining area. The entertainer’s kitchen combines honed marble benchtops with a sophisticated palette, contrasting light oak flooring with twin AEG ovens, towering skylights, and a butler’s pantry complete with a sink, wine fridge, and ample storage. French doors open outward to a heated plunge pool, beautifully framed by a porthole window set in meticulously hand-laid stonework.

Connected via a central breezeway, the three generously sized bedrooms occupy the second 'pod,' headlined by a luxurious main suite. This private retreat includes walk-in and fitted robes, a sunlit study nook, and a travertine-clad ensuite. Additional features include a double remote garage with off-street parking for two vehicles, a second luxe bathroom, a large laundry, auto irrigation, an outdoor shower, keyless entry, an alarm system, CCTV, and reverse-cycle heating and cooling.
